导航:首页 > 编程语言 > java获取所有字段

java获取所有字段

发布时间:2023-12-04 23:21:31

1. Java如何获得一个对象中所有带set方法的字段(形成Field对象)包括父类的。有现成的工具类

在Java中 是获取不了对象里面的字段的(除非是一些固定写死的字段) ,但是可以利用反射获取set方法,进行赋值
具体可以参考一下代码
/**
*
* @param obj 赋值对象
* @param value 赋值的值
* @throws Exception
*/
public void setMethod(Object obj ,String value) throws Exception{
if (obj == null ) {
return;
}
Method[] methods = obj.getClass().getMethods();
for (int i = 0; i < methods.length; i++) {
Method method = methods[i];
String name = method.getName();
if(name.contains("set")){
method.invoke(obj,value);
}
}

}

阅读全文

与java获取所有字段相关的资料

热点内容
扬州和无锡哪个适合程序员 浏览:288
德弗变频器编程键 浏览:779
普通吸管可以做什么解压玩具 浏览:700
命令行执行exe 浏览:837
如何单独测试压缩机 浏览:860
禁止修改ip命令 浏览:727
ip转向源码下载 浏览:121
西安什么app能交养老保险 浏览:422
当程序员遇到产品 浏览:978
己亥pdf 浏览:862
jpg格式怎么改成文件夹 浏览:576
用window编程plc 浏览:94
程序员到阿里技术总监之路 浏览:410
怎么把pdf合在一起 浏览:370
直线命令英语 浏览:112
编译系统程序在主存储器里吗 浏览:905
java开发工作经验 浏览:793
群英服务器如何 浏览:486
php获取不到cookie 浏览:849
备案云服务器类型 浏览:995